What country led the United Nations or UN forces against North Korea?

What country led the United Nations or UN forces against North Korea?

the United States
United Nations Security Council Resolutions 83 and 84 provided the international legal authority for member states to restore peace on the Korean Peninsula, and they designated the United States as the leader of the unified command we know as UN Command.

What countries are not part of the UN explain?

The two countries that are not UN members are Vatican City (Holy See) and Palestine. Both are considered non-member states of the United Nations, allow them to participate as permanent observers of the General Assembly, and are provided access to UN documents.

Who Recognised USA first?

Morocco was one of the first countries to recognize the newly independent United States, opening its ports to American ships by decree of Sultan Mohammed III in 1777.

When was South Korea recognized by the United Nations?

In December 12, 1948, South Korea was officially recognized by the UN General Assembly (UNGA) under Resolution 195. Since then, South Korea participated in the GA as an observer. In 1950, North Korea invaded South Korea, and the Korean War commenced. The UN Security Council took action in Korea.

Will North Korea be admitted to the United Nations General Assembly?

In the General Assembly, the recommended state must receive a two-thirds majority after voting in order for the nation to be fully admitted. In the case of North Korea, the United Nations Security Council approved the United Nations Security Council Resolution 702 that recommended both North and South Korea to the United Nations General Assembly.
